The zero-point energy of the vibration of ${ }^{35} \mathrm{Cl}_{2}$ mimicking a harmonic oscillator with a force constant $\mathrm{k}=2293.8 \mathrm{Nm}^{-1}$ is
(a)$10.5 \times 10^{-21} \mathrm{J}$
(b)$14.8 \times 10^{-21} \mathrm{J}$
(c)$20 \times 10^{-21} \mathrm{J}$
(d)$29.6 \times 10^{-21} \mathrm{J}$
Answer
Answer (as printed): B
